RFIJF Started Through an Online Platform

Wednesday, November 4, 2020 11:56 AM

Erbil, KURDISTAN (November 3, 2020) - Rwanga Foundation announced the starting of the Rwanga Foras International Job Fair 2020 through a press conference.



This is the fifth job fair held by Rwanga Foundation, but this year, due to challenges that were caused by the Covid-19 pandemic, the job fair is held online through a smart platform where young people can visit the companies and see the job opportunities, and can also watch a variety of trainings and panels through the same platform.

“We are always trying to take the initiative to build a positive impact, and the Rwanga Foras International Job Fair is one of these initiatives we have been holding annually since 2016." Although we did not expect the job fair to be this successful due to the current situations caused by the Corona virus this year, but we are so happy today to announce the RFIJF 2020 with the participation of more than 100 companies and organizations” said Abdul Salam Medeni, Chief Executive Director of Rwanga Foundation.


The Rwanga Foras International Job Fair 2020 will be available online for three days (November 3, 4 and 5) from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. More than 100 companies and organizations have participated and published more than 5000 job vacancies.


Apart from job vacancies, young people can also benefit from the six different training courses that are conducted online through the platform on the topics of ‘employability skills mainly about CV Writing, Interview Techniques, and Work Ethics’.


In order to provide more opportunities for young people, more than 300 Internship opportunities are announced by the companies and organizations. The Rwanga forum will be held as one of the other activities during the fair, which will include three panel discussions, the panels will be held online and offline and will be broadcasted directly on the platform and the media channels.
